Judy Huth: 5 Fast Facts You Need to Know

Bill Cosby Lawsuit

Bill Cosby’s latest accuser says that the comedian molested her when she was 15 years old at the Playboy Mansion. Judy Huth says the incident occurred back in 1974 and she’s finally filing suit against Cosby in Los Angeles seeking damages.

Here’s what you need to know:


1. Huth Says Cosby Took Her to the Playboy Mansion as a ‘Surprise’

Huth claims that she and a friend were invited guests to Bill Cosby’s Los Angeles tennis club on a day back in 1974. According to court documents, Cosby met the girl’s on a movie set. He gave the girls beer as the three played billiards together inside the private club. Eventually he said he was taking the girl’s somewhere and that the destination was a “surprise.” The “surprise” turned out to be the Playboy Mansion. They all went to a bedroom in the mansion, at which point Huth went to use the bathroom. When she returned, Cosby was in a bed, says the suit. She sat on the bed and he “proceeded to sexually molest her by attempting to put his hand down her pants, and then taking her hand in his hand and performing a sex act on himself without her consent.”

2. Huth Says Cosby Caused Her ‘Psychological Injuries & Illnesses’

Due to the statute of limitations in the state of California, Huth could only have pursued criminal charges if the attack had happened in 1988 at the latest. In her case, Huth, a native of Riverside County, California, says she suffered from “psychological injuries and illnesses” in the aftermath of Cosby’s alleged attack. The lawsuit reads:

This traumatic incident, at such a tender age, has caused psychological damage and mental anguish for the plaintiff that has caused her significant problems throughout her life.


3. Huth Lied About Her Age at the Playboy Mansion

According to documents, Cosby had told Huth, then 15, and her friend, who was 16, to lie about their ages if asked at the Playboy Mansion. The two girls told staff that they were 19. In return, Huth and her friend were “served with multiple alcoholic beverages.”


4. Huth’s Account Is Eerily Similar to the Stories Told By Cosby’s Other Alleged Victims

The amount of compensation being sought by Huth is unknown. In 2005, it was reported that Andrea Constand accused Cosby of drugging and sexually assaulting her. The claim was settled out of court. During that lawsuit, Constand’s lawyers said she had over a dozen women ready to testify that Cosby had similarly abused them.


5. Cosby, as Usual, Remains Silent

Neither Cosby, nor his attorney, have responded to this specific claim, but previous allegations were referred to as “unsubstantiated, fantastical stories” by his lawyers.
